Iams Hit With Lawsuit Over Pet Food Claims San Francisco Chronicle 3-10-2001 Los Angeles - A pet owner has sued Iams pet food, claiming the advertising by the company overstates the nutritional value of its dog food. The suit seeks class-action status for consumers who bought Iams' Chunks, Eukanuba, Less Active and other products since April 1999. Iams is owned by Procter & Gamble Co., the largest U.S. maker of household products. P&G could not be immediately reached for comments. |

In the summer of 2000, discouraged with the different foods we had been feeding, we decided to research the subject, and after much time and energy spent, changed to Flint River Ranch dog food.
Our main reasons for this change were that we wanted to find a food that was "The Best" for our Vizslas. Something that was made of all human-grade ingredients, with no by-products, without toxic preservatives and without the controversial bioengineered corn, -or bioengineered anything!.
We wanted a food that had the right percentage of protein, fat and fiber for our active dogs, with minerals that were chelated, including Selenium, which we feel prevents early grayness and B vitamins for healthy skin. We wanted a food that was stool hardening, to help in intestinal and anal gland health.

| Guaranteed Analysis | Average As Fed | |||
| Adult/Puppy formula analysis | Senior formula analysis | Adult/Puppy formula analysis | Senior formula analysis | |
| Crude protein (Min.) | 23.0 % | 16.0 % | 23.5 % | 16.7 % |
| Crude Fat (Min.) | 12.0 % | 8.0 % | 12.30 % | 8.4 % |
| Crude Fiber (Min.) | 4.0 % | 5.0 % | 2.25 % | 3.0 % |
| Moisture (Max.) | 10.0 % | 10.0 % | 8.80 % | 8.8 % |
| Ash (Max.) | 9.0 % | 9.0 % | 8.50 % | 8.7 % |
| Caloric Density (KCAL/Lb.) | 1780 | 1739 | ||
| Caloric Density (KCAL/C) | 477 | 421 | ||
| Grams/Cup | 121 | 110 | ||
| Adult/Puppy formula Vitamin/Mineral Assay (Assay per kilogram) | Senior Formula Vitamin/Mineral Assay (Assay per kilogram) | |
| Vitamin A | 11,600 IU | 11,060 IU |
| Vitamin D | 1,060 IU | 1,020 IU |
| Vitamin E | 120 IU | 95 IU |
| Vitamin C | 40.0 mg | 40.0 mg |
| Thiamin (B1) | 9.1 mg | 9.2 mg |
| Riboflavin (B2) | 11.6 mg | 11.6 mg |
| Pantothenic Acid | 44.0 mg | 44.0 mg |
| Niacin | 65.0 mg | 47.5 mg |
| Pyroxidine | 9.6 mg | 9.6 mg |
| Folic Acid | 1.6 mg | 1.6 mg |
| Biotin | 1.30 mg | 1.62 mg |
| Vitamin B12 | 0.30 mg | 0.20 mg |
| Calcium | 1.50 % | 1.40 % |
| Phosphorous | 1.00 % | 1.00 % |
| Potassium | 0.50 % | 0.50 % |
| Sodium | 0.38 % | 0.36 % |
| Chloride | 0.33 % | 0.52 % |
| Magnesium | 0.10 % | 0.14 % |
| Iron | 208.00 mg | 220.00 mg |
| Copper | 12.00 mg | 10.00 mg |
| Manganese | 54.00 mg | 54.00 mg |
| Zinc | 125.00 mg | 125.00 mg |
| Iodine | 3.0 mg | 3.1 mg |
| Selenium | 0.26 mg | 0.26 mg |
| Calcium/Phosphorous Ratio | 1.50/1.00 | 1.40/1.00 |
Ingredients for the Adult/Puppy formula: Chicken Meal, Whole Wheat Flour, Ground Rice, Lamb Meal, Poultry Fat (preserved with Tocopherols and Ascorbic Acid), Ground Wheat, Flaxseed, Dried Whole Egg, Lecithin, Fish Meal, Brewers Dried Yeast, Wheat Germ Meal, Dried Kelp, Dehydrated Alfalfa Meal, Salt, Potassium Chloride, Ferrous Sulfate, DL-Alpha Tocopherol Acetate (Source of Vitamin E), Zinc Oxide, Selenium Supplement, Manganous Oxide, Riboflavin Supplement (Vitamin B2), Copper and Cobalt, Niacin, Ascorbic Acid (Source of Vitamin C), Vitamin B12 Supplement, Vitamin A Supplement, Calcium Panthothenate, D-Biotin Supplement, Pyridoxine Hydrochloride (Vitamin B6), Calcium Iodate, Thiamine Mononitrate, Folic Acid, Vitamin D3 Supplement.
Ingredients for the Senior formula: Whole Wheat Flour, Ground Rice, Chicken Meal, Ground Whole Wheat, Oatmeal, Poultry Fat (preserved with Tocopherols and Ascorbic Acid), Oat Bran, Lamb Meal, Flaxseed, Dried Whole Egg, Fish Meal, Brewers Dried Yeast, Wheat Germ Meal, Lecithin, Kelp, Dehydrated Alfalfa Meal, Salt, Potassium Chloride, Monosodium Phosphate, Choline Chloride, Ferrous Sulfate, DL-Alpha Tocopherol Acetate (Source of Vitamin E), Zinc Oxide, Sodium Selenite, Manganous Oxide, Riboflavin Supplement (Vitamin B2), Copper Sulfate, Amino Acid Chelates of Zinc, Iron, Manganese, Copper and Cobalt, Niacin, Ascorbic Acid (Source of Vitamin C), Vitamin B12 Supplement, Vitamin A Supplement, Calcium Panthothenate, D-Biotin Supplement, Pyridoxine Hydrochloride (Vitamin B6), Calcium Iodate, Thiamine Mononitrate, Folic Acid, Vitamin D3 Supplement."
